Test no. 1634
The Ashes - 4th Test
Australia v England
2002/03 season

Played at Melbourne Cricket Ground on 26,27,28,29,30 December 2002 (5-day match)

Result Australia won by 5 wickets

Australia 1st innings R M B 4s 6s SR
JL Langer c Caddick b Dawson 250 578 407 30 1 61.42
ML Hayden c Crawley b Caddick 102 189 149 10 3 68.45
RT Ponting b White 21 40 32 3 0 65.62
DR Martyn c Trescothick b White 17 38 30 3 0 56.66
captain SR Waugh c wicketkeeperFoster b White 77 159 117 15 0 65.81
ML Love not out 62 160 141 4 0 43.97
wicketkeeper AC Gilchrist b Dawson 1 9 6 0 0 16.66
    Extras (lb 11, w 5, nb 5) 21
    Total (6 wickets dec; 146 overs; 588 mins) 551 (3.77 runs per over)

Did not bat B Lee, JN Gillespie, SCG MacGill, GD McGrath

Fall of wickets1-195 (Hayden, 44.2 ov), 2-235 (Ponting, 53.5 ov), 3-265 (Martyn, 63.6 ov), 4-394 (Waugh, 103.3 ov), 5-545 (Langer, 143.5 ov), 6-551 (Gilchrist, 145.6 ov)

 Bowling O M R W Econ
 AR Caddick 36 6 126 1 3.50 (3nb, 1w)
 SJ Harmison 36 7 108 0 3.00 (1nb)
 C White 33 5 133 3 4.03 (1nb)
 RKJ Dawson 28 1 121 2 4.32
 MA Butcher 13 2 52 0 4.00 (4w)

England 1st innings R M B 4s 6s SR
ME Trescothick c wicketkeeperGilchrist b Lee 37 93 75 6 1 49.33
MP Vaughan b McGrath 11 26 17 2 0 64.70
MA Butcher lbw b Gillespie 25 111 78 3 0 32.05
captain N Hussain c Hayden b MacGill 24 87 58 3 0 41.37
RKJ Dawson c Love b MacGill 6 22 18 1 0 33.33
RWT Key lbw b Lee 0 4 2 0 0 0.00
JP Crawley c Langer b Gillespie 17 61 45 2 0 37.77
C White not out 85 182 134 9 3 63.43
wicketkeeper JS Foster lbw b Waugh 19 76 76 0 0 25.00
AR Caddick b Gillespie 17 30 30 1 1 56.66
SJ Harmison c wicketkeeperGilchrist b Gillespie 2 16 14 0 0 14.28
    Extras (b 3, lb 10, nb 14) 27
    Total (all out; 89.3 overs; 364 mins) 270 (3.01 runs per over)

Fall of wickets1-13 (Vaughan, 6.2 ov), 2-73 (Trescothick, 22.4 ov), 3-94 (Butcher, 32.1 ov), 4-111 (Dawson, 37.6 ov), 5-113 (Key, 38.4 ov), 6-118 (Hussain, 41.6 ov), 7-172 (Crawley, 54.2 ov), 8-227 (Foster, 76.5 ov), 9-264 (Caddick, 85.5 ov), 10-270 (Harmison, 89.3 ov)

 Bowling O M R W Econ
 GD McGrath 16 5 41 1 2.56 (2nb)
 JN Gillespie 16.3 7 25 4 1.51 (1nb)
 SCG MacGill 36 10 108 2 3.00
 B Lee 17 4 70 2 4.11 (7nb)
 SR Waugh 4 0 13 1 3.25

England 2nd innings (following on) R M B 4s 6s SR
ME Trescothick lbw b MacGill 37 68 46 5 1 80.43
MP Vaughan c Love b MacGill 145 277 218 19 3 66.51
MA Butcher c Love b Gillespie 6 36 29 0 0 20.68
captain N Hussain c & b McGrath 23 91 70 3 0 32.85
RWT Key c Ponting b Gillespie 52 127 109 7 0 47.70
JP Crawley b Lee 33 137 105 3 0 31.42
C White c wicketkeeperGilchrist b MacGill 21 95 62 3 0 33.87
wicketkeeper JS Foster c Love b MacGill 6 22 13 1 0 46.15
RKJ Dawson not out 15 57 45 2 0 33.33
AR Caddick c Waugh b MacGill 10 27 19 1 0 52.63
SJ Harmison b Gillespie 7 11 15 1 0 46.66
    Extras (b 3, lb 21, w 2, nb 6) 32
    Total (all out; 120.4 overs; 477 mins) 387 (3.20 runs per over)

Fall of wickets1-67 (Trescothick, 15.6 ov), 2-89 (Butcher, 24.6 ov), 3-169 (Hussain, 48.5 ov), 4-236 (Vaughan, 69.4 ov), 5-287 (Key, 81.1 ov), 6-342 (Crawley, 104.5 ov), 7-342 (White, 105.3 ov), 8-356 (Foster, 109.5 ov), 9-378 (Caddick, 117.5 ov), 10-387 (Harmison, 120.4 ov)

 Bowling O M R W Econ
 GD McGrath 19 5 44 1 2.31
 JN Gillespie 24.4 6 71 3 2.87
 SCG MacGill 48 10 152 5 3.16
 B Lee 27 4 87 1 3.22 (6nb, 2w)
 SR Waugh 2 0 9 0 4.50

Australia 2nd innings (target: 107 runs) R M B 4s 6s SR
JL Langer lbw b Caddick 24 92 56 1 0 42.85
ML Hayden c sub (AJ Tudor) b Caddick 1 10 2 0 0 50.00
RT Ponting c wicketkeeperFoster b Harmison 30 41 35 3 1 85.71
DR Martyn c wicketkeeperFoster b Harmison 0 3 3 0 0 0.00
captain SR Waugh c Butcher b Caddick 14 30 25 2 0 56.00
ML Love not out 6 25 14 0 0 42.85
wicketkeeper AC Gilchrist not out 10 20 13 2 0 76.92
    Extras (b 8, lb 5, nb 9) 22
    Total (5 wickets; 23.1 overs; 113 mins) 107 (4.61 runs per over)

Did not bat B Lee, JN Gillespie, SCG MacGill, GD McGrath

Fall of wickets1-8 (Hayden, 2.1 ov), 2-58 (Ponting, 11.2 ov), 3-58 (Martyn, 11.5 ov), 4-83 (Waugh, 18.1 ov), 5-90 (Langer, 18.5 ov)

 Bowling O M R W Econ
 AR Caddick 12 1 51 3 4.25 (2nb)
 SJ Harmison 11.1 1 43 2 3.85 (7nb)

Toss Australia, who chose to bat first
Series Australia led the 5-match series 4-0

Test debut ML Love (Australia)
Player of the match JL Langer (Australia)

Umpires DL Orchard (South Africa) and RB Tiffin (Zimbabwe)
TV umpire DB Hair
Match referee Wasim Raja (Pakistan)

Close of play
26 Dec day 1 - Australia 1st innings 356/3 (JL Langer 146*, SR Waugh 62*, 90 ov)
27 Dec day 2 - England 1st innings 97/3 (N Hussain 17*, RKJ Dawson 0*, 34 ov)
28 Dec day 3 - England 2nd innings 111/2 (MP Vaughan 55*, N Hussain 8*, 34 ov)
29 Dec day 4 - Australia 2nd innings 8/0 (JL Langer 4*, ML Hayden 1*, 2 ov)
30 Dec day 5 - Australia 2nd innings 107/5 (23.1 ov) - end of match
